protected void Page_Show(object sender, EventArgs e)
        {
            Utility.buildListBox(ddlType.Items, "select typeID,Name from bm_PavilionType", "typeID", "Name", null, "");
            Utility.buildListBox(ddlSunny.Items, "select ID,Name from bm_Sunny", "ID", "Name", null, "");

            if (p_theID.Value.Length > 0)
            {
                string sWhere = "";

                sWhere += "paID=" + CCUtility.ToSQL(p_theID.Value, FieldTypes.Number);

                string         sSQL      = "select * from Pavilion where " + sWhere;
                SqlDataAdapter dsCommand = new SqlDataAdapter(sSQL, Utility.Connection);
                DataSet        ds        = new DataSet();
                DataRow        row;

                if (dsCommand.Fill(ds, 0, 1, "Table") > 0)
                {
                    row         = ds.Tables[0].Rows[0];
                    theID.Value = CCUtility.GetValue(row, "paID");
                    //System.Web.UI.WebControls.TextBox[] tempBox={tbName,tb,btNote,btP1,btP2,btPhone,btMemo};
                    tbName.Text      = CCUtility.GetValue(row, "Name");
                    tbHigh.Text      = CCUtility.GetValue(row, "High");
                    tbArea.Text      = CCUtility.GetValue(row, "Area");
                    tbLayer.Text     = CCUtility.GetValue(row, "Layer");
                    tbBuildDate.Text = CCUtility.GetValue(row, "BuildDate");
                    tbMemo.Text      = CCUtility.GetValue(row, "Memo");
                    //类型
                    string s = CCUtility.GetValue(row, "typeID");
                    try
                    {
                        ddlType.SelectedIndex = ddlType.Items.IndexOf(ddlType.Items.FindByValue(s));
                    }
                    catch {}
                    //朝向
                    s = CCUtility.GetValue(row, "sunnyID");
                    try
                    {
                        ddlSunny.SelectedIndex = ddlSunny.Items.IndexOf(ddlSunny.Items.FindByValue(s));
                    }
                    catch {}
                }
            }
        }
示例#2
0
        private void Search_Show()
        {
            Utility.buildListBox(ddlDMList.Items, "select ID,Name from bm_bm", "ID", "Name", null, "");
            string s = Utility.GetParam("paID");

            try
            {
                ddlDMList.SelectedIndex = ddlDMList.Items.IndexOf(ddlDMList.Items.FindByValue(s));
            }
            catch { }
        }
示例#3
0
        void Search_Show()
        {
            Utility.buildListBox(ddlPavilion.Items, "select paID,Name from Pavilion ", "paID", "Name", "请选择", "");

            string s;

            s           = Utility.GetParam("search");
            tbRoom.Text = s;

            s = Utility.GetParam("paID");
            try
            {
                ddlPavilion.SelectedIndex = ddlPavilion.Items.IndexOf(ddlPavilion.Items.FindByValue(s));
            }
            catch { }
        }
        protected void Page_Show(object sender, EventArgs e)
        {
            Utility.buildListBox(ddlCell.Items, "select ID,Name from bm_Cell", "ID", "Name", null, "");
            Utility.buildListBox(ddlSunny.Items, "select ID,Name from bm_Sunny", "ID", "Name", null, "");
            Utility.buildListBox(ddlType.Items, "select ID,Name from bm_Indoor", "ID", "Name", null, "");
            //楼名称
            tbPaName.Text    = Utility.Dlookup("pavilion", "Name", "paID=" + CCUtility.ToSQL(paID.Value, FieldTypes.Number));
            tbPaName.Enabled = false;

            if (p_theID.Value.Length > 0)
            {
                string sWhere = "";

                sWhere += "hoID=" + CCUtility.ToSQL(p_theID.Value, FieldTypes.Number);

                string         sSQL      = "select * from House where " + sWhere;
                SqlDataAdapter dsCommand = new SqlDataAdapter(sSQL, Utility.Connection);
                DataSet        ds        = new DataSet();
                DataRow        row;

                if (dsCommand.Fill(ds, 0, 1, "Table") > 0)
                {
                    row         = ds.Tables[0].Rows[0];
                    theID.Value = CCUtility.GetValue(row, "hoID");
                    paID.Value  = CCUtility.GetValue(row, "paID");

                    tbRoom.Text  = CCUtility.GetValue(row, "hoRoom");
                    tbLayer.Text = CCUtility.GetValue(row, "hoFloor");
                    tbArea.Text  = CCUtility.GetValue(row, "hoArchArce");
                    tbArea2.Text = CCUtility.GetValue(row, "hoUseArce");

                    tbClientName.Text = CCUtility.GetValue(row, "Client_Name");
                    tbClientID.Text   = CCUtility.GetValue(row, "CLIENT_CARD");
                    tbPhone.Text      = CCUtility.GetValue(row, "CLIENT_PHONE");
                    tbClientCard.Text = CCUtility.GetValue(row, "CLIENT_ACCOUNT_NUMBER");
                    tbUseDate.Text    = CCUtility.GetValue(row, "USE_DATE");
                    tbUnit.Text       = CCUtility.GetValue(row, "COMPANY_NAME");

                    tbMemo.Text = CCUtility.GetValue(row, "Memo");
                    //类型
                    string s = CCUtility.GetValue(row, "indoorID");
                    try
                    {
                        ddlType.SelectedIndex = ddlType.Items.IndexOf(ddlType.Items.FindByValue(s));
                    }
                    catch { }
                    //单元
                    s = CCUtility.GetValue(row, "cellID");
                    try
                    {
                        ddlCell.SelectedIndex = ddlCell.Items.IndexOf(ddlCell.Items.FindByValue(s));
                    }
                    catch { }
                    //朝向
                    s = CCUtility.GetValue(row, "sunnyID");
                    try
                    {
                        ddlSunny.SelectedIndex = ddlSunny.Items.IndexOf(ddlSunny.Items.FindByValue(s));
                    }
                    catch { }
                }
            }
        }